Identification of a novel prognosis-associated ceRNA network in lung adenocarcinoma via bioinformatics analysis
Abstract Background Lung adenocarcinoma (LUAD) is the most common subtype of nonsmall-cell lung cancer (NSCLC) and has a high incidence rate and mortality.
